What is Fenugreek? (Methi Seeds, Leaves, Tea) + Side Effects

WebMay 7, 2024 · Fenugreek is an annual herb with light green leaves and small white flowers. It’s part of the pea family ( Fabaceae) and also known as Greek hay ( Trigonella foenum-graecum ). WebDec 31, 2024 · Fenugreek. Fenugreek ( Trigonella foenum-graecum) is a culinary herb belonging to the legume family Fabaceae. It is known as methi in India and is valued for its medicinal properties aside from its culinary importance. This spice has been around for centuries and proliferates in semi-arid regions.
